Each type of appliance is designed to tackle orthodontic issues big and small, but they differ in look and function. The types of braces we offer include:

Traditional Metal Braces: These braces are a classic treatment that uses metal brackets, stainless steel wires, and elastics to transform your smile. This appliance has been upgraded over recent years, so patients benefit from a more discreet and effective treatment.

Clear Braces: Clear braces may be a perfect choice if you’re excited about getting braces but want a treatment that isn’t as noticeable as the metal appliance. These braces function similarly to metal braces, but instead of stainless steel brackets, they consist of a series of clear brackets that blend in with the color of your natural smile. While this appliance is highly effective, it’s slightly less durable than the metal version.

Damon Braces: One of the most exciting breakthroughs in braces technology is the creation of Damon braces. Orthodontic experts and engineers researched what qualities made a smile look more natural and beautiful and then created a type of braces that aimed to help your smile reflect these qualities.

Rather than using regular brackets and elastics, Damon braces use a patented slide mechanism that allows the wire to move freely throughout treatment. Elastics can cause friction that slows your progress and keeps you in treatment longer. With this unique appliance, there is little friction, so you enjoy a quicker treatment. The lack of rubber bands also gives you the opportunity to have better oral health because it is easier to brush around these smooth and sleek brackets.
